Output 1139663136fffa3016131c9f7fb390daa52017647de8b27c27c44a392ee99f77:61

value
30843
script pubkey
OP_0 OP_PUSHBYTES_20 7bce21e08d6ebef8e0c9c83f2120fff4e433dee4
address
bc1q008zrcydd6l03cxfeqljzg8l7njr8hhy0y90vk
transaction
1139663136fffa3016131c9f7fb390daa52017647de8b27c27c44a392ee99f77
spent
true